Price-to-Earnings Ratio (P/E)

The P/E ratio divides Reflect Scientific's share price by its earnings per share. It tells you how many years of current earnings you are "paying for" when you buy the stock. A P/E of 20 means you pay $20 for every $1 of annual earnings. The S&P 500 historically trades at an average P/E of roughly 15–17. A P/E significantly above that may signal high growth expectations; one below may indicate undervaluation — or declining business quality.

Price-to-Sales Ratio (P/S)

The P/S ratio divides market capitalization by total revenue. Unlike the P/E ratio, it works even for companies that are not yet profitable, making it essential for evaluating high-growth firms. A P/S below 1.0 may indicate undervaluation, while ratios above 10 are typically reserved for fast-growing tech or SaaS companies with high expected future margins.

Price-to-EBIT Ratio

This ratio relates Reflect Scientific's market price to its operating earnings, excluding the effects of debt structure and tax jurisdiction. It is particularly useful for comparing companies across different countries or with different levels of leverage, because it focuses purely on operational profitability. Lower values suggest cheaper operational earnings.

What does Reflect Scientific do? Reflect Scientific Inc is a US-based manufacturer and supplier of cooling technologies used in various industries and applications. The company was founded in 1995 and is headquartered in Orem, Utah. The history of Reflect Scientific began in the 1990s when the company developed a cooling technology specifically for use in medical research and the pharmaceutical industry. This technology eventually became known as the "FreezePoint" cooling system and is now one of Reflect Scientific's most well-known products. Today, the company has several divisions through which it offers its cooling technology. The main divisions include: - Medical and pharmaceutical cooling - Food and beverage cooling - Refrigeration for industrial applications - Transportation and storage cooling Reflect Scientific's business model is based on selling cooling technology systems and devices to customers in various industries. The company focuses on high-quality and innovative products that have high energy efficiency and low environmental impact. Customer service is also an important part of Reflect Scientific's business model. The company offers a wide range of services to its customers, including consultation, installation, maintenance, and repair of its cooling technology systems. Some of the key products offered by Reflect Scientific include: - FreezePoint cooling systems: This specialized cooling technology has been developed for use in medical research and the pharmaceutical industry. The system uses a combination of dry ice and ethanol to maintain samples and medications at temperatures as low as -80°C. - Ultra-Low-Temperature cooling systems: These systems are designed for the cold storage of bioproducts such as tissues and cells. They are also suitable for storage of sperm and eggs in reproductive medicine. - Cooling devices for the food and beverage industry: Reflect Scientific offers a wide range of cooling devices specifically designed for the requirements of the food and beverage industry. These include refrigerators, freezers, display cases, and cooling shelves. - Refrigeration for industrial facilities: Reflect Scientific also offers refrigeration systems designed for use in industrial facilities such as factories, laboratories, and hospitals. These systems can be set to temperatures as low as -100°C and are capable of cooling large quantities of materials. - Transportation and storage cooling: Reflect Scientific also offers cooling technology systems specifically designed for the transportation and storage of sensitive goods such as medications, vaccines, and food. These systems are capable of maintaining a constant temperature during transport, ensuring the quality and safety of the goods.
